From fa1f9b4100da8fd2c90802dbffc21f76d7b9f5ba Mon Sep 17 00:00:00 2001 From: zch Date: Thu, 10 Jul 2025 18:18:53 +0800 Subject: [PATCH] =?UTF-8?q?refactor(system):=20=E7=BE=8E=E5=8C=96=E6=A0=B7?= =?UTF-8?q?=E5=BC=8F=E6=96=B0=E7=89=88=E6=9C=AC=EF=BC=8C=E5=A4=87=E4=BB=BD?= =?UTF-8?q?=EF=BC=9A=E6=9C=AA=E7=BE=8E=E5=8C=96=E3=80=81=E7=94=A8=E6=88=B7?= =?UTF-8?q?=E5=8F=AA=E8=83=BD=E4=BF=AE=E6=94=B9=E5=9B=BE=E6=A0=87=E3=80=81?= =?UTF-8?q?=E8=8F=9C=E5=8D=95=E5=90=8D=E7=A7=B0=E3=80=81=E9=A1=BA=E5=BA=8F?= =?UTF-8?q?=E7=9A=84=E4=B8=BAbackup2?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- 优化页面布局,使用卡片化设计 - 改进搜索表单样式,增加标签加粗和间距调整 - 更新表格样式,增加斑马纹和悬浮高亮效果 - 调整对话框样式,优化表单项和按钮布局 - 新增部分功能: - 菜单图标选择功能 -展开/折叠全部菜单功能 - 修改菜单时显示菜单名称 - 取消新增菜单的直接添加功能 - 删除菜单功能 - 优化代码结构,提高可维护性 --- src/views/system/menu/backuo2.vue | 331 ++++++++++++++++++++++++++++++ src/views/system/menu/index.vue | 222 ++++++++++++++------ 2 files changed, 491 insertions(+), 62 deletions(-) create mode 100644 src/views/system/menu/backuo2.vue diff --git a/src/views/system/menu/backuo2.vue b/src/views/system/menu/backuo2.vue new file mode 100644 index 0000000..49073e8 --- /dev/null +++ b/src/views/system/menu/backuo2.vue @@ -0,0 +1,331 @@ + + + diff --git a/src/views/system/menu/index.vue b/src/views/system/menu/index.vue index 21dfefa..fb40c26 100644 --- a/src/views/system/menu/index.vue +++ b/src/views/system/menu/index.vue @@ -1,31 +1,32 @@ + - - - - - - - - - - - - - - - - - - - - - - - - - +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+ @@ -293,7 +311,7 @@ export default { getMenu(row.menuId).then(response => { this.form = response.data; this.open = true; - this.title = "修改菜单"; + this.title = `修改菜单 - ${row.menuName}`; this.isEdit = true; }); }, @@ -329,3 +347,83 @@ export default { } }; + +